music_streaming

Hi folks... another interesting tidbit of information: The music_player does support streaming - there's just no way to tell it the url (it does not support .m3u).

But a simple script does the trick (at least for me )... it reads the url from a textfile on SDCard (see README.txt).
Enjoy...

P.S.: The stop-Script can also help you if you inadvertedly went into standby with the music player running. It will just kill any running instance of the music_player. (context: going into standby while playing music in the background on FW1.7RC26/03/12 occasionaly makes the player inaccessible)

Update 04/04/12 16:07+01:00 [13] : I've added a script to make adding urls to the textfile more convenient. It looks out for entries in .m3u and .pls files in the downloads directory of the SDCard and adds them. This way, you may click on the playlist links with the browser, and add the urls without tedious copy-paste efforts.

np - welcome (it really is just a _very_ simple script, eventually maybe someone may add proper .m3u support - that'd be the clean solution )

But as already mentioned, I currently lack the time for bigger projects.
After a quick search on ad-blocking though:
- browser is claimed to be webkit (-based?) in another thread.
- http://vogue-android.blogspot.de/200...itandroid.html claims an adblock integration for webkit (but patch does refer to android source... no clue how compatible)
- I don't see the browser source in the git repository - if there are more than trivial changes to it to make it run with them M92 gui_shell integration, this'd be work.
- privoxy ( http://www.privoxy.org/ ) may be a workaround in the meantime (it's an ad-filtering proxy you could install on a regular machine - or (possibly) compile for the M92)

I personally just disable the image autoloading (use it mostly for news paper reading, anyway ). Btw.: I'd really like to see a 'load images' icon in the upper toolbar for this configuration setting :P
You might want to add ad-blocking to the wishlist, though - maybe someone'll find the time to do it. At least the privoxy port sounds plausible to me.
